Columbus McKinnon Corporation is a global leading designer, manufacturer and provider of intelligent motion and material handling solutions, including hoists, cranes, lifting equipment, and industrial automation systems. It mainly serves industrial, construction, logistics, and energy sectors across North America, Europe and Asia Pacific, delivering safe, efficient productivity solutions for heavy-duty operation scenarios.
